Job Description Job Description Job Title: Job Shop Machinist Pay & Shift $20-$28hr 1st Shift - Monday - Thursday 6:00am - 4:00pm (OT on Fridays and some saturdays. Job Description Machinists will be working in a job shop environment making parts for industrial clients. The shop is equipped with multiple manual lathes and presses as well as 2 new Okuma CNC machines. The machinist will be responsible for setting up, changing out, and running machines, as well as reading blueprints to create specific parts. Responsibilities Set up, change out, and operate manual and CNC machines. Read and interpret blueprints to create specific parts. Operate manual lathes and presses. Ensure precision and quality in the machining process. Essential Skills Experience with CNC machining. Ability to read and interpret blueprints. Experience with machine setups and change outs. Additional Skills & Qualifications Experience with manual machining is a plus. Familiarity with lathe and press machines. Tool and die skills. Why Work Here? Great family-owned company offering the opportunity to transition to a direct position. Enjoy a balanced work week with four 10-hour shifts and minimal overtime. Work with a supportive and dedicated team in a stable and rewarding environment. Work Environment The job shop operates from Monday to Thursday from 6:00 AM to 4:30 PM, with occasional overtime on Fridays and some Saturdays. The shop is equipped with multiple manual lathes, presses, and two new Okuma CNC machines, providing a dynamic and well-equipped work environment. Job Type & Location This is a Contract to Hire position based out of Ellabell, Georgia. Pay and Benefits The pay range for this position is $20.00 - $28.00/hr.
